<B>Rope (Warner Brothers, 1948)</B></I> Three Sheet (41" X 81"). Adapted from Patrick Hamilton's stage play, "Rope" was the first Alfred Hitchcock film shot in color. Two college students kill a third just for the thrill of it. The boys hide the body in a chest in the middle of their apartment, then arrange to hold a dinner party in the same room, inviting the victim's family, friends, fiancée, and their college professor. James Stewart plays the intellectual professor (Cadell), whose lectures the boys claim were their inspiration for the murder. The tension mounts as Stewart starts to suspect that something is amiss, eventually discovering the awful truth. There are creases, a slight amount of separation at one crossfold, a small embossed censor stamp and some light edge wear and soiling. A fantastic large format for this Hitchcock classic. Very Fine.
